CAST 122 Drawing and Design for Metal Casting

This course provides students with a basic understanding of Design and Visual Communication skills required to develop and present concepts that may be realized in Cast Molten Metal. Students will gain the ability to integrate 2D/3D concepts and to combine aesthetics with function when articulating their creative visions 'on paper' as an adjunct to working with Cast Metal.
